| 2016-01-26 | Rough implementation of `execute` | Danny Navarro | |
| The first end-to-end test taken from `graphql-js` passes but this still needs to be extended to support more general cases. - `Data.GraphQL.Schema` has been heavily modified to support the execution model. More drastic changes are expected in this module. - When defining a `Schema` ordinary functions taking fields as input are being used instead of maps. This makes the implementation of `execute` easier, and, arguably, makes `Schema` definitions more *Haskellish*. - Drop explicit `unordered-containers` dependency. `Aeson.Value`s and field functions should be good enough for now. | |||
